A J Brenton t/a Manton Electrical Components -v- Jack Palmer

Friday, 19 January 2001

Key terms: 
Party to contract – Jurisdiction – Error of Fact

Brenton applied for summary judgment to enforce an Adjudicator’s decision. Palmer argued that the Adjudicator did not have jurisdiction to make his decision as the true party to the contract was not Palmer himself but his company, Lords of Princetown Limited. The Judge decided that, as the Adjudicator made the finding that Mr Palmer was a party to the contract, and referring to The Project Consultancy Group v The Trustees of the Gray Trust and Macob v Morrison, this was a decision that the Adjudicator was empowered to make under the Act. If the Adjudicator had made an error in coming to that decision, it was an error of fact that was within his jurisdiction to determine. As such, the decision was enforced.
